>>>>>[Well, after several months of running around Lone Star, the FBI,
InterPol, and whoever else has been trying to turn Redmond into thier own private hunting
grounds, trying to find my new clinic before I got it up and running, I'm pleased to
announce that it's back up.

Contact your street docs if you want us to do work, as we're
working on referral only, although there may be the
occcasional exception. That limits our exposure and also
shows you that we're reputable....unless you have a drekky
street doc, that is.

Just to reiterate the precautions, you contact us via your
doc or fixer. We accept or deny you based on whether we
think you constitute a security risk or not, and your
ability to pay our bill. If we accept you, you are given a
location and a time, and if you're not there when we pull up
in our vehicle, you're SOL. You deactivate any and all
tracking and locating devices, turn over all weapons, and
agree to whatever additional security the driver and
assistant require, or we drive away. If you try to sneak
any of them in under the cyberscanners, chemsniffers, MRI
weapon scanners, and other detectors we have in the car,
you'll either be thrown out of the car, or, if you
successfully make it to the clinic, you'll be killed
immediately, NO exceptions. This is just so you know the
rules.

But we're back in business.]<<<<<
